LiF is often a chemically stable crystal, but it can be delicate to humidity and atmospheric impurities, which may impact its optical Homes. As a result, LiF optical parts needs to be diligently managed and stored in order to avoid contamination.
Lithium fluoride is the material with quite possibly the most extreme UV transmission of all and it is employed for Unique UV optics. Lithium fluoride transmits effectively into the VUV area in the hydrogen Lyman-alpha line (121nm) and further than.

Lithium fluoride is used in Home windows, lenses and prisms in vacuum ultraviolet, ultraviolet, obvious and infrared.
With the development of deep ultraviolet technological innovation in recent years, Lithium Fluoride Crystals are greatly utilized for deep ultraviolet, on account of its large transmittance during the deep ultraviolet region and limited cutoff wavelengths.
